2.1 Introducción al prompting
Introducción al Prompting y a la ingeniería de prompts
La ingeniería de prompts es una disciplina relativamente reciente que se centra en diseñar, formular y optimizar las instrucciones que damos a los modelos de lenguaje para obtener respuestas más útiles, precisas y ajustadas a nuestras necesidades. En lugar de limitarse a “hacer preguntas”, el prompting consiste en aprender a comunicarse eficazmente con la IA, entendiendo cómo interpreta el lenguaje y cómo responde a distintos tipos de instrucciones.
Esta disciplina resulta clave para comprender tanto las capacidades como las limitaciones de los grandes modelos de lenguaje (LLMs). Saber escribir buenos prompts permite aprovechar mejor su potencial, pero también entender cuándo pueden fallar, inventar información o responder de forma ambigua.
En el ámbito de la investigación, la ingeniería de prompts se utiliza para mejorar el rendimiento de los LLMs en tareas muy diversas, desde la respuesta a preguntas complejas hasta el razonamiento lógico o aritmético. En el ámbito del desarrollo, se emplea para diseñar interacciones robustas y repetibles, capaces de integrarse en aplicaciones reales junto con otras herramientas y sistemas.
Sin embargo, la ingeniería de prompts no se limita a escribir una instrucción inicial. Incluye un conjunto amplio de técnicas y habilidades que permiten guiar el comportamiento del modelo: asignarle roles, proporcionar contexto, introducir ejemplos, estructurar el formato de salida o limitar explícitamente lo que puede y no puede hacer. En este sentido, el prompting se convierte en una competencia clave para interactuar de forma consciente, crítica y eficaz con los modelos de lenguaje.
Además, un buen prompting contribuye a mejorar la seguridad y fiabilidad de los LLMs, ayudando a reducir respuestas inapropiadas, ambiguas o fuera de contexto. También permite ampliar sus capacidades mediante la incorporación de conocimiento específico de un dominio concreto o el uso combinado con herramientas externas.
El creciente interés por los modelos de lenguaje ha motivado la creación de guías, recursos y marcos de trabajo centrados en la ingeniería de prompts, que recopilan buenas prácticas, ejemplos, técnicas avanzadas y aplicaciones reales. En el contexto educativo, el prompting no solo es una habilidad técnica, sino también una competencia comunicativa y cognitiva, muy relacionada con saber formular buenas preguntas, dar instrucciones claras y reflexionar sobre el tipo de respuestas que buscamos.
Ventajas de un buen prompting
Un uso adecuado de la ingeniería de prompts aporta múltiples beneficios, tanto en contextos educativos como profesionales:
-
Respuestas de mayor calidad
Instrucciones claras y bien estructuradas reducen ambigüedades y aumentan la precisión de las respuestas. -
Mayor coherencia y control
Permite guiar el tono, el nivel de profundidad y el enfoque de la respuesta, evitando salidas genéricas o irrelevantes. -
Fomento de respuestas creativas (cuando interesa)
Un buen prompt puede estimular la creatividad del modelo, proponiendo enfoques originales, analogías o ejemplos novedosos. -
Uso de ejemplos como guía
Incluir ejemplos en el prompt ayuda al modelo a entender mejor el tipo de respuesta esperada (learning by example). -
Restricción y delimitación de respuestas
Es posible limitar el formato, la extensión, el vocabulario o incluso prohibir ciertos tipos de contenido. -
Adaptación al contexto educativo o profesional
Permite ajustar las respuestas a un nivel concreto (ESO, FP, universidad) o a un ámbito específico (técnico, humanístico, divulgativo). -
Mejor aprovechamiento del tiempo
Reduce la necesidad de correcciones posteriores y de múltiples intentos. -
Mayor fiabilidad y seguridad
Ayuda a minimizar errores, alucinaciones y respuestas fuera de contexto. -
Comprensión crítica de la IA
Enseña a interactuar con los modelos de forma consciente, entendiendo que la calidad de la salida depende en gran parte de la calidad de la instrucción.